Win a Pair of Tickets to See Yael Deckelbaum and Diwan Saz at Variety Playhouse

Israeli artists Yael Deckelbaum and Diwan Saz headline the main event of the Annual Atlanta Jewish Music Festival this Saturday at Variety Playhouse. You can win a pair of tickets!

Where: Variety Playhouse (1099 Euclid Ave NE 30307)

When: Saturday, March 21

Doors 7:45 PM, Music 8:45 PM, age 13+ only

About Atlanta Jewish Music Festival: “AJMF6 is going to be our biggest and best yet,” Founder and Director Russell Gottschalk said. “I’m most excited about the spotlight we’ve given Israeli performers at our Main Event, offering Atlantans and visitors from around the South a chance to connect to Israel here at home. But we also continue to support local Jewish musicians and over half of our featured performers live in the Greater Atlanta area. From our smallest stage on Opening Night to the huge crowd at the ACFB Hunger Walk/Run, from our local talents to our international rock stars, there is something for everyone at our signature Spring Festival.”
